SeaBright Holdings is a holding company. Through its wholly-owned subsidiary, SeaBright Insurance Company, Co. operates as an underwriter of multi-jurisdictional workers' compensation insurance. Through its other wholly-owned subsidiaries, PointSure Insurance Services, Inc. and Paladin Managed Care Services, Inc., Co. also provides related wholesale brokerage services and managed medical care services. SeaBright Insurance Company is licensed in 49 states, the District of Columbia and Guam, to write workers' compensation and other lines of insurance.
